    Tony Tubbs had never been stopped and had skill and toughness ,fast hands.
    He came in with that extra weight hanging off him.
    But for a brief time he showed flashes of how good he could be.
    That was another impressive display from Tyson, putting Tubbs down in the second.

    Carl "The Truth" Williams had all the tools, size, style to give Tyson some trouble at least for awhile. He just had a flaw that he that left him open to a lefthook.
